The Palestinian Prisoners' Media Office warned today, Monday, that the Zionist enemy continues to prevent lawyer visits to prisoners inside its prisons, stressing that this increases sconcerns about the escalating violations against them being covered up.

In a statement issued today, the Prisoners' Media Office indicated that approximately 500 male and female prisoners have been denied legal visits over the past ten days, a move it described as a dangerous escalation of the policy of isolation and repression.

It explained that the Zionist prison administration has decided to cancel lawyer visits until further notice, exacerbating the prisoners' isolation and increasing concerns about their conditions, especially with the occupation courts postponing hearings and limiting them to holding detention extension and administrative detention sessions only.

The Prisoners' Media added that this measure is an extension of the comprehensive isolation policy pursued by the Zionist enemy since October 7, 2023. This policy also includes preventing family and Red Cross visits, and depriving prisoners of their essential belongings, exacerbating their detention conditions to an unprecedented degree.
